Kraken Could Launch Stock Trading Features Soon 

US-based cryptocurrency exchange Kraken is currently exploring the option to offer stocks and exchange-traded funds (ETFs) for trading. 

This is according to a Bloomberg report on Wednesday, citing a person close to the matter. Per the report, Kraken will initially offer the service to traders in the United States and the UK. The crypto exchange will offer stock trading via a new service built by a new division called Kraken Securities. 

Kraken already has the necessary regulatory permits in the UK and has also applied with the United States Financial Industry Regulatory Authority to become a broker-dealer. 

If this happens, Kraken would become the first cryptocurrency exchange to offer trading outside cryptocurrency assets. Bloomberg added that Kraken intends to launch the service in 2024. 

Robinhood and Wealthsimple are some of the traditional trading platforms that currently offer access to some cryptocurrency assets. 

A Kraken spokesperson commented that,

“Kraken is always exploring how it can power the global adoption of cryptocurrencies. While we can’t comment on rumors or speculation, we’re looking to broaden and enhance our offering so clients continue to have secure and seamless access to Kraken’s full product suite.” 

Kraken has increased its efforts to expand its services outside the United States as the regulatory scrutiny in the US continues to increase.
